A massive fire threatening Fox Lake is now moving east, away from the remote northern Alberta community, said Conroy Sewepagaham, chief of the Little Red River Cree Nation.

The Paskwa fire at Fox Lake, 150 kilometres east of High Level, is among the fires currently defying suppression efforts.Firefighters are working to tame hot spots but the forecast is not encouraging, Sewepagaham said.

Little Red River Cree Nation is made up of three communities — Fox Lake, Garden River and John D'Or Prairie. Indigenous Services Canada is helping set up temporary housing in John D'Or Prairie for 500 people, including a commercial kitchen and other amenities. He said it's unclear when residents can safely return home. The damage is extensive and smoke persists in the air.Alberta residents scramble to defend their properties from wildfires, and some say there's been a lack of help from the province.

In Sturgeon Lake Cree Nation, 45 structures, including homes and the community's elder centre, have been destroyed. Around 1,600 people from the community have been evacuated to nearby Grande Prairie and Valleyview, and also to Edmonton.
